The Team here is proud to announce the 9th Alliance Tournament is on its way and will be kicking off this June!

We'll be spicing up the rule set once again and bringing in some new faces and fresh ideas for EVE TV's coverage. There will be a full dev blog on the tournament itself in a few weeks which will cover the rules and sign up details.

For those who missed the last one - all the matches from Alliance Tournament VII and VIII are available on CCP's YouTube channel.

EVE TV's Player Expert Team

We will once again be opening up the application process for players who would like to be PVP Experts, these elite players are handpicked by us to fly out to Iceland for the tournament finals played over two weekends.

As an Expert you'll be on the set discussing the tournament, tactics, teams and talking with developers about EVE live on air. You'll also take shifts in the commentary booth providing live commentary on the matches themselves. You need to know your PvP and you need to know how to keep on talking!

Alliance Tournament IX will take place over two weekends in June, You'll be flown out to Reykjavik, Iceland to join the team here at CCP HQ to help us run the show during the live broadcast of the final weekend. Flights (from all Icelandair destinations) and accommodation are supplied by us. All you need is a little spending money.
